top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

        区块链之间的通信方式解析:如何实现高效交互

        • 2025-07-08 11:58:50
            在过去的几年里,区块链技术已经取得了巨大的发展,尤其是在金融、物流、供应链和智能合约等各个行业的应用。然而,随着越来越多的区块链网络的出现,这些网络之间的通信问题也越来越突出。不同的区块链系统由于采用了不同的协议、共识机制和技术框架,导致它们之间的互操作性存在着诸多挑战。因此,了解区块链之间的通信方式及其发展趋势,对推动区块链技术的广泛应用具有重要意义。 ### 区块链之间的通信方式概述 区块链之间的通信方式主要可以分为以下几类: 1. **跨链协议**:这是最直接的方式,专门设计用于不同区块链网络之间的通信。这类协议允许不同链上的资产、数据和信息进行安全地传输。 2. **中继链**:中继链是一种特殊的区块链,它可以连接两个或多个具有不同协议的区块链,使其能够以安全的方式进行交互。中继链负责转发信息和数据,确保各条区块链的共识机制互不干扰。 3. **侧链技术**:侧链是一种独立的区块链,可以与主链资产互通。通过将资产从主链转移到侧链,用户可以在侧链上进行不同的操作。这种方式实现了资产在链之间的流转。 4. **原子交换**:原子交换是一种智能合约技术,允许不同区块链之间直接交易资产,而不需要中介。交换操作一旦开始,要么全部成功,要么完全失败,确保交易的安全性。 5. **去中心化交换 (DEX)**:去中心化交易平台支持不同区块链资产进行交易,用户能够在无需信任中介的情况下,直接进行资产交换。这些交易所通过智能合约来保障交易的安全和透明。 ### 问题与解答 ####

            跨链协议如何工作?

            跨链协议是实现不同区块链网络之间通信的核心技术之一。其工作机制通常包括以下几个步骤:

            首先,跨链协议定义了一套标准,允许不同的区块链系统通过这些标准进行通信。例如,许多跨链协议会使用中立的标识符来代表链上的资产或数据,使得其能够在不同链间进行有效识别。

            其次,跨链协议通常依赖于中介层,或称为网关。这些中介层会在不同区块链间建立桥梁,确保信息传递的安全性和准确性。比如,某种资产要从以太坊区块链转移到比特币区块链,首先需要通过一个合约锁定该资产,同时在另一链上生成相应的表示,以此实现资产的流动。

            最后,跨链协议还涉及到共识算法的协调,确保不同区块链间的可信性。例如,如果某个链上的数据或资产得到确认,跨链协议会通过验证机制来确保这一确认在其他链上也得到相应的认可。这种多层次的验证可以有效降低双重支付的风险。

            ####

            中继链的优势与局限性

            中继链作为连接多个区块链的重要环节,拥有其独特的优势,但也存在一定的局限性。

            优势方面,中继链能够提供高度的互操作性,使得不同区块链间的信息和资产可以快速流动。它通过抽象化不同区块链的复杂性,让开发者可以更加专注于应用层,而无需关注底层的协议细节。此外,采用中继链技术可以增强安全性,因为所有的交互都将在中继链的保护下进行,避免了直接的链与链之间的交互带来的潜在风险。

            然而,中继链也并非没有局限性。首先,中继链设计和维护的复杂性较高,建立一个高效、低延迟的中继链需要丰富的技术积累和资源投入。其次,若中继链受到攻击或发生故障,可能会影响到所有连接的区块链的安全性和功能性。此外,中继链在性能上也可能会有一定的瓶颈,尤其是在处理大量事务时,可能成为整个系统的性能瓶颈。

            ####

            如何利用侧链实现资产的跨链转移?

            侧链技术是实现资产跨链转移的有效手段之一,其基本思路是在主链和侧链之间进行资产的转换。

            具体步骤如下:用户首先需要将主链上的资产进行“锁定”,以确保在创建侧链资产的同时,主链上的资产不被使用。通常,这种锁定过程会通过智能合约来实现,保证过程的安全性。

            然后,用户在侧链上得到相应价值的资产表示,用户可以在侧链上进行各种交易或操作。当用户需要将资产返回主链时,他们可以通过智能合约将侧链上的资产解锁,并在主链上释放相应的资产。

            侧链的优势在于用户可以在侧链上进行更高效的交易,甚至运行不同的协议,从而获得更多的功能和灵活性。同时,侧链还可以改善主链的可扩展性,减少主链的负荷。

            然而,使用侧链也有一定的风险。侧链相对独立,可能面临着安全性和信任的问题。一旦侧链出现漏洞,用户的资产可能会遭受损失。因此,确保侧链的安全性与稳定性成为开发者面临的一个重大挑战。

            ####

            原子交换技术的实现机制是什么?

            原子交换是一种创新的机制,允许不同区块链之间直接交易资产,确保无需中心化的中介。

            原子交换的核心是在不同链之间进行的智能合约交易。首先,交易双方需要创建一个原子合约,这个合约可以承担约定的资产和交易细节。在这个合约中,若任何一方违约,交易将自动回滚,确保双方的权益。

            原子交换的过程通常包括以下几个步骤:第一步,交易双方需要交换各自的公钥,以便设定合约;第二步,在第一条区块链上锁定一部分资产,并生成一个哈希作为标识;第三步,第二方使用锁定资产的哈希生成自己的证明,经过验证后,第一方也得到相应的资产;最后,通过智能合约统筹这些操作,确保资产的安全与交互的顺利进行。

            这种模式的最大优势在于消除了信任中介的需要,同时降低了交易成本,并加速了交易过程。然而,原子交换技术的复杂性也限制了其广泛应用。用户需要有一定的技术知识和经验,才能有效使用这一技术。

            ####

            去中心化交换(DEX)对传统交易所的影响

            去中心化交易所(DEX)是近年来区块链领域迅速发展的交易方式,对传统中心化交易所的影响显而易见。

            首先,DEX的去中心化特性使得用户对自身资产拥有完全的控制权。与传统交易所不同,用户不需要将自己的资产存入交易所账户,而是在自己的钱包中进行交易。这一变化显著降低了资产被盗或交易所崩溃带来的风险,这在2017年及2018年的几次重大黑客事件中表现得尤为明显。

            其次,DEX通常提供更高的交易透明度。所有交易信息都被记录在区块链上,用户可以随时查阅。这意味着,用户可以更全面地了解市场动态,做出更加明智的交易决策。此外,去中心化交易所也允许用户直接进行多种不同资产的交易,而无需在多个中心化平台进行繁琐的转换。

            然而,DEX还面临不少挑战。交易速度和效率常常比中心化交易所低,因为每笔交易都需要通过区块链验证。此外,市场流动性也是一个问题,较小的DEX可能无法与大型中心化交易所竞争,导致用户面临较高的滑点风险。

            ### 结论 综上所述,区块链之间的通信方式有着丰富的选择,包括跨链协议、中继链、侧链技术、原子交换等。每一种方式都有其独特的优势与局限,随着技术的不断发展,针对不同应用场景的需求,区块链之间的互操作性将不断提高,为各行各业带来更多的可能性与机遇。在未来,能够实现高效、安全的区块链通信机制,将是推动整个区块链生态系统持续健康发展的重要基础。
            • Tags
            • 区块链,区块链通信,区块链互操作性